- Company Overview for MLMI UK LIMITED (07515916)
- Filing history for MLMI UK LIMITED (07515916)
- People for MLMI UK LIMITED (07515916)
- More for MLMI UK LIMITED (07515916)
There are no persons with significant control or statements available for this company.